Output 50670597688a8db982a3d153c11995c79b3ed54ff9dc87a33333fff8eea7d017:19
- value
- 1707529
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d58110fa7626fb2cf5496bc364b5d1a02833c7cd OP_EQUAL
- address
- 3M9vU67FZ3bKwwmatVQrUwW1qVpEziqh64
- transaction
- 50670597688a8db982a3d153c11995c79b3ed54ff9dc87a33333fff8eea7d017
- spent
- true